    Hi Sabrina,

    You may not be able to establish a company but you may still be able to work as a contractor (as a sole trader, independent contractor). Ask immigration if you can work as a sole trader whilst on silver fern visa.
    I am an independent contractor, sole trader, but do not have a registered company of my own. I use my persoanl IRD number as GST number. If we setup a company, we need to get new IRD number for company which will be its GST number. Also, you need to register for GST only if your annual income is expected to be over $60k (i think its $60K but please confirm).

    Another important question to ask is, What type of job offer do you need to have to apply for 2 yr silver fern job experience visa? The most obvious answer would be permanent job in IT field. But ask them if a contract job offer (contract of service) is acceptable or not? However even if they say it's acceptable, you should have at least 12 months contract with possible extension when you apply. You can apply as an exception especially for job in IT sector but your employer must support you firmly.

    Remember, you could also do 3 month contract for now and find a permanent job for you before you finish your 9 month visa.
